Dynamics of a Self-Starting Kerr-Lens-Mode-Locking Using a Semiconductor Saturable Absorber Mirror

    The self-starting dynamics of the Kerr-leiis mode-locking (KLM) in a Ti. sapphire laser using an intracavity broadband semiconductor saturable absorber mirror (SESAM) was investigated experimentally. The mechanism of the self-starting KLM using a SESAM was investigated and discussed.
